[Bug target/105058] Incorrect register constraint in KL patterns

2022-03-26 Thread hjl.tools at gmail dot com via Gcc-bugs
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=105058 H.J. Lu changed: What|Removed |Added Resolution|--- |FIXED Status|UNCONFIRMED

[Bug target/105058] Incorrect register constraint in KL patterns

2022-03-26 Thread cvs-commit at gcc dot gnu.org via Gcc-bugs
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=105058 --- Comment #3 from CVS Commits --- The releases/gcc-11 branch has been updated by H.J. Lu : https://gcc.gnu.org/g:f0ed5f0763933de8287b3e01aa7fd3efdd77d485 commit r11-9695-gf0ed5f0763933de8287b3e01aa7fd3efdd77d485 Author: H.J. Lu Date: Fri

[Bug target/105058] Incorrect register constraint in KL patterns

2022-03-26 Thread cvs-commit at gcc dot gnu.org via Gcc-bugs
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=105058 --- Comment #2 from CVS Commits --- The master branch has been updated by H.J. Lu : https://gcc.gnu.org/g:ede5f5224d55b84b9f186b288164df9c06fd85e7 commit r12-7829-gede5f5224d55b84b9f186b288164df9c06fd85e7 Author: H.J. Lu Date: Fri Mar 25

[Bug target/105058] Incorrect register constraint in KL patterns

2022-03-26 Thread crazylht at gmail dot com via Gcc-bugs
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=105058 --- Comment #1 from Hongtao.liu --- cat test.c #include unsigned int ctrl; __m128i k1, k2, k3; void test_keylocker_11 (void) { register __m128i k4 __asm ("xmm16") = k2; asm volatile ("" : "+v" (k4)); _mm_loadiwkey (ctrl, k1,